Solar System Cost Breakdown: Panels, Installation & More
Understanding the total expense of a solar setup involves more than just the PV panels themselves. A significant share of the expenditure goes towards installation , which usually includes technicians' charges , permitting, and tools. Collector values fluctuate widely based on supplier, performance , and capacity. Beyond panels and installation , other expenses may arise from converter selection, reserve solutions (if needed), and required electrical modifications to your residence 's wiring . Factoring in these aspects provides a accurate understanding of the monetary commitment.

Factors Affecting Home Solar System Costs
Several aspects impact the total price of a home solar installation. First off, the output of the desired power generation is a significant factor . More expansive installations undeniably demand more modules , which increases the upfront investment . Furthermore, the kind of power cells chosen – such as monocrystalline versus multi-crystalline – can present a considerable effect on costs . In addition to the panels themselves, workmanship charges fluctuate based on location , company pricing , and the intricacy of the setup . Finally, licensing costs and anticipated incentives can also noticeably modify the final price .
